QUANTIFYING PROBABILITIES USING OPTIMIZATION TECHNIQUES

Abstract

The effort is to quantitatively assess the impact of uncertain parameters within mathematical optimization programs, with particular emphasis on networks. As the DoD and economies in general are becoming more reliable on networks, it is becoming increasingly important that their merits and vulnerabilities are understood. Links between nodes of a communications-materials network can fail, and these failures adversely affect performance. Given known probability distributions for which the links can fail, the desire is to determine the overall probability that the network is able to satisfy pre-specified minimum thresholds of flow. These overall probabilities define the reliability of a network, and are critical when making decisions as to design and enhancement.
